(540) 741-5500
Primary Specialties
Cardiology (Board Certified)
(540) 368-5603
Urgent Care (Board Certified)
(540) 899-1615
Pulmonary (Board Certified)
(540) 372-2028
Psychiatry (Board Certified)
(540) 899-1600
Dermatology (Board Certified)
(540) 741-2865
General Surgery (Board Certified)
Trauma (Board Certified)
(540) 741-2955
Bariatric Surgery (Board Certified)
(540) 374-3277
Infectious Disease (Board Certified)
(540) 741-1100
(540) 898-8001
Family Practice (Board Certified)